I use VisualBoyAdvance, so if you're using that one to it's Options > Sound and then there should be some sound channels listed in there. Just click to toggle it on and off and hear the results. I used Tools > Record > Start sound recording... to record it (After turning the sound effects off to isolate the music, of course). It's a bit lengthy because I have to go through and mute all the channels I don't want playing then record and let the song play through while it's being recorded.Fifo wrote:How did you do that??THEdragon, on Nov 11, 2013, wrote:Has anyone tried running Rayman Advance on an emulator that allows the muting and un-muting of individual sound channels, and recording each individual channel of certain music tracks? Actually, the two designs from the intro to Rayman and the world map are consistent, if you look carefully; they're just from different perspectives. In between the hills with increasing altitude on the world map, there must be a canyon cutting right through it like you can see in the intro. In fact, there is. Look at the world map and watch the waterfall from Mr. Stone's peaks fall down behind the other hills, into a canyon between the hills. I think the world map shows in flat-on sideways view what the intro views from 'the front'. The forest stretches from the far foreground to the far background and also snakes through behind the hills; Band Land is in the far foreground, Picture City is slightly behind that, behind that is the Candyland Chateaû and furthest back are Mr. Stone's peaks. Rotate that view 90º and you get what you see in the intro. 
(the shape of the hills in the intro and the world map seem slightly inconsistent, but that could still add up considering what is blocking what, exactly)
